3. Is a spotting scope worth it?
If you're hunting large game out West or in wide-open areas, spotting scopes are great for setting up and getting a long-distance shot in. For wooded and confined areas or you're doing spot & stalk hunting that requires more movement on the hunter's part, a pair of high-quality binoculars will suit their needs more.
